fix: Resolve NotificationManager import conflict
Use alias for our custom NotificationManager to avoid conflict with android.app.NotificationManager
This commit is contained in:
parent
e3b68c9c21
commit
4462bf4cdf
|
|
@ -9,7 +9,7 @@ import com.inou.clawdnode.gateway.DirectGateway
|
||||||
import com.inou.clawdnode.security.AuditLog
|
import com.inou.clawdnode.security.AuditLog
|
||||||
import com.inou.clawdnode.security.DeviceIdentity
|
import com.inou.clawdnode.security.DeviceIdentity
|
||||||
import com.inou.clawdnode.security.TokenStore
|
import com.inou.clawdnode.security.TokenStore
|
||||||
import com.inou.clawdnode.service.NotificationManager
|
import com.inou.clawdnode.service.NotificationManager as AppNotificationManager
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* ClawdNode Application
|
* ClawdNode Application
|
||||||
|
|
@ -53,7 +53,7 @@ class ClawdNodeApp : Application() {
|
||||||
// Set up command handlers
|
// Set up command handlers
|
||||||
DirectGateway.onNotificationAction = { notificationId, action, replyText ->
|
DirectGateway.onNotificationAction = { notificationId, action, replyText ->
|
||||||
auditLog.log("COMMAND_RECEIVED", "notification.action: $action on $notificationId")
|
auditLog.log("COMMAND_RECEIVED", "notification.action: $action on $notificationId")
|
||||||
NotificationManager.getInstance()?.triggerAction(notificationId, action, replyText)
|
AppNotificationManager.getInstance()?.triggerAction(notificationId, action, replyText)
|
||||||
}
|
}
|
||||||
|
|
||||||
DirectGateway.onCallAnswer = { callId ->
|
DirectGateway.onCallAnswer = { callId ->
|
||||||
|
|
|
||||||
Loading…
Reference in New Issue